Mom's note:
 
The other night I gave Toby this toy that had been marinating in nip for some time. He had a big reaction but I thought he just had a major nip high. Turns out, his tooth got stuck in the curly fabric and broke off. A fact that I discovered about 4pm this afternoon, and immediately rushed him off to the vet.
 
They gave him a shot for inflammation, and I have to give him antibiotics. On Friday we return for a full dental, which he needs anyway - again! we just had one last November - and the root extraction, because of course it didn't have the decency to just come out too.
 
When I came home I hunted for the tooth. As far as I can tell, it WAS healthy, just embedded in the fabric. I guess it got stuck, he pulled away hard and that was that.
